Tar roof repair services focus on addressing issues with flat or low-sloped roofing systems typically found on commercial buildings, garages, or extensions of residential homes. These projects often involve fixing leaks, replacing damaged or deteriorated sections, sealing seams, or patching areas affected by weather or aging.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the materials used, and how the repairs will restore the roof's integrity to prevent future leaks or damage.

Before requesting tar roof repair, homeowners and property owners should assess the extent of the damage and consider the age of the existing roofing system. It’s helpful to identify visible signs of wear, such as cracks, blisters, or pooling water, and to understand the typical lifespan of tar roofing materials. Clear communication about the specific issues and the desired outcome can ensure that the repair work meets the property’s needs and provides a durable solution.

Tar Roof Repair Questions

What causes damage to a tar roof? Exposure to harsh weather, UV rays, and standing debris can lead to cracks, blisters, and deterioration of tar roofs.

How can I tell if my tar roof needs repairs? Signs include leaks, visible cracks, blistering, or areas where the surface appears worn or damaged.

What types of repairs are common for tar roofs? Repairs often involve patching cracks, sealing blisters, and replacing damaged sections to restore waterproofing.

Is it better to repair or replace a damaged tar roof? Repair is suitable for localized damage, while widespread issues may require a roof replacement for long-term durability.
